Brief summary
The objectives of the study are to characterize urea production rates in patients with OTC, characterize the association of rate of ureagenesis and disease severity in OTC patients, characterize the association of rate of ureagenesis and executive and verbal function and characterize the association of rate of ureagenesis and patient-reported functional status.
Detailed description
Study DTX301-CL102 is a noninterventional, observational study to characterize the rate of ureagenesis and to assess neurocognition and functional status in the spectrum of OTC deficiency and their association with biochemical characteristics. \[1-13C\]Sodium acetate will be administered orally as a tracer to measure the rate of ureagenesis.

Eligibility
Inclusion criteria
Key Inclusion Criteria: * Willing and able to provide written informed consent. * For symptomatic patients: * Confirmed clinical diagnosis of OTC deficiency and enzymatic, biochemical, or molecular testing. * Documented history of ≥ 1 symptomatic hyperammonemic episode with ammonia level ≥ 100 μmol/L * Patients on ongoing daily ammonia scavenger therapy must be at a stable dose(s) for ≥ 4 weeks prior to Visit 1 (Baseline) * For asymptomatic patients: confirmed diagnosis of OTC deficiency by family history and documented by molecular testing. * Willing and able to comply with the study procedures and requirements, including clinic visits, blood and urine collections, questionnaires, and cognitive assessments. Key
Exclusion criteria
* Liver transplant, including hepatocyte cell therapy/transplant. * History of liver disease * Significant hepatic inflammation or cirrhosis * Participation in another investigational medicine study within 3 months of Screening * Participation (current or previous) in another gene transfer study * Pregnant or nursing Other protocol specific criteria may apply
